Product Description

cis-1,3-Dimethylcyclohexane undergoes ring opening reaction via dicarbene mechanism in the presence of iridium catalyst supported on SiO2.
1,3-Dimethylcyclohexane was used to study ring opening reaction of 1,3-dimethylcyclohexane over Iridium catalysts modified by the addition of K and Ni.

Chemical and Physical Properties

Refractive Index n20/D 1.426 (lit.)
Flash Point(°F) 48.2 °F
Flash Point(°C) 9 °C
Molecular Weight 112.210 g/mol
XLogP3 3.800
Hydrogen Bond Donor Count 0
Hydrogen Bond Acceptor Count 0
Rotatable Bond Count 0
Exact Mass 112.125 Da
Monoisotopic Mass 112.125 Da
Topological Polar Surface Area 0.000 Ų
Heavy Atom Count 8
Formal Charge 0
Complexity 58.400
